Witryna12 kwi 2024 · RO can remove contaminants including many inorganics, dissolved solids, radionuclides and synthetic organic chemicals. RO can also be used for removing salts from brackish water or sea water. NF is useful for removal of hardness, color and odor compounds, synthetic organic chemicals and some disinfection byproduct precursors. WitrynaTherefore, many of these contaminants may be present in industrial wastewater. In addition domestic sewage contains many organic pollutants from diffuse sources such as PAHs from car exhaust emissions, coal/wood combustion and road runoff and dichlorobenzenes from household disinfectants.
